Frequently Asked Questions
How much does Roof Vent Installation cost in Virginia?
In Virginia, the cost of roof vent installation typically ranges from $300 to $1,500, depending on factors such as the complexity of your roof, the type of vents used, and local labor rates. Areas with higher living costs, like Northern Virginia, may see prices on the higher end. Additionally, weather-related delays, especially during the winter months with snow, can impact overall costs.
How do I choose a reliable contractor nearby?
To choose a reliable contractor for roof vent installation in Virginia, check for local licenses and insurance, as Virginia requires contractors to be licensed for roofing work. Look for reviews and ratings on local directories, and ask for references from previous clients. It's also beneficial to get multiple quotes to compare services and pricing.
How long does this type of work usually take?
Roof vent installation in Virginia generally takes one to two days, depending on the number of vents being installed and the complexity of your roof. Weather conditions, such as rain or snow, can delay the process, particularly in winter months. Ensure you discuss timelines with your contractor to set realistic expectations.
Is it safe to handle the repairs on my own?
Handling roof vent installation on your own can be risky due to the potential for falls and the need for specialized tools. Virginia's weather can also complicate DIY efforts, especially during storms or extreme temperatures. It's advisable to hire a licensed professional who understands local building codes and safety regulations.
What are the common signs that I need Roof Vent Installation?
Common signs that you may need roof vent installation in Virginia include excessive heat buildup in your attic, visible moisture or mold, and high energy bills. If you notice any signs of roof damage or inadequate ventilation, such as sagging ceilings or peeling paint, it may be time to consider installing vents. Local humidity levels can exacerbate these issues, making proper ventilation crucial.
Are there specific state regulations for Roof Vent Installation in Virginia?
Yes, Virginia has specific regulations regarding roof vent installation, including the requirement for contractors to be licensed. Local building codes may also dictate the type and placement of vents to ensure proper ventilation and compliance with safety standards. Always check with your local building department for specific requirements in your area.
What is the best season to start the project?
The best season for roof vent installation in Virginia is typically spring or fall, when temperatures are moderate and weather conditions are more stable. Summer can be hot and humid, while winter may bring snow and ice, complicating the installation process. Scheduling your project during milder months can help ensure a smoother installation.
